Tragedy on I-65: One Dead in White County Crash
Nov 08, 2025 at 05:29 am
A fatal crash on I-65 in White County claims one life and injures two. Details on the early morning collision and ongoing investigation.

Another day, another reminder of how quickly things can change on the road. This morning, a crash on I-65 in White County resulted in one fatality and injuries to two others, shaking up the start to the day for many.
Early Morning Mayhem on I-65
The incident occurred near mile marker 197. According to initial reports, a 2018 Freightliner tractor-trailer was heading southbound in the right lane, with a 2020 Hino box truck in the left lane. Then, things went sideways. For reasons still under investigation, the Hino truck veered into the right lane and collided with the trailer of the Freightliner.
One Life Lost, Two Injured
While both drivers survived, thankfully with non-life-threatening injuries, the passenger in the Hino truck wasn't so lucky. They were pronounced dead at the scene. As of now, the victim's name hasn't been released, adding to the somber atmosphere surrounding this incident. Both drivers were taken to a nearby hospital.
Investigation Underway
The crash is still under investigation, and authorities are working to piece together exactly what happened. What caused the Hino truck to swerve? Was it driver fatigue, mechanical failure, or something else entirely? Only time and a thorough investigation will tell.
